The Prophet: A Documentary's Journey to Jerusalem (2026)

The upcoming documentary, 'The Prophet', is set to make its highly anticipated debut in Jerusalem, marking a significant moment in the city's cultural landscape. This film, directed by Melissa Francis, offers a compelling narrative that intertwines personal stories with broader societal implications, particularly in the context of Israel's recent history. The documentary's focus on Erez Eshel, a former Israeli paratrooper, provides a unique perspective on the events of October 7, 2023, and the aftermath that followed.

His journey from a military background to leadership education and his role in promoting leadership and citizenship among young Israelis adds depth to the narrative. This personal arc not only provides insight into Eshel's experiences but also offers a window into the social divisions and challenges faced by Israel in the 1990s.

One thing that immediately stands out is the film's use of intercutting between Eshel's present-day story and footage from the 1990 documentary 'To Be an Officer'. This technique creates a compelling visual narrative, allowing viewers to see the evolution of Eshel's life and the impact of his experiences over time. The documentary aims to explain Israel's experience to viewers outside the country, particularly in the United States, and to help them understand the shock and impact of the attack. The film's screening in Jerusalem, with the participation of US Ambassador Mike Huckabee, further emphasizes its significance as a cultural and diplomatic event.

Looking ahead, the film's planned release in theaters across the United States in 2026 could have a significant impact on public discourse.
